> Back to the media codecs: They are loaded by libmedia and thus indirectly
> by the program (at least there's no separate process).

Again this may just be stepping around the details of the GPL and not
the spirit, but what about having some sort of separate process for
media add-ons (or at least GPL ones?) I guess performance might
suffer, but personally I'd like these areas improved in performance
because of the multi-process browser design I want to implement :)

Plus it might be useful to have a general purpose system for
out-of-process add-ons for robustness (taking Tracker add-ons out of
process for example...we can't count on all of them being written
right.)

Though this might be too much to tackle for the alpha (and/or you all
think I'm crazy...)
